ONE PAN ROASTED CHICKEN THIGHS & GOLDEN POTATOES  W/ HOMEMADE TZATZIKI SAUCE

INGREDIENTS:
Homemade Tzatziki:
  • 1 container of greek yogurt
  • ½ cucumber - diced and seeded ( To seed: Lay the cucumber on a cutting board and cut the cucumber in half lengthwise with a sharp knife. Gently scoop out the seeds by gliding the tip of a spoon and dice).
  • ½ freshly squeezed lemon
  • 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 tbsp garlic powder
  • 1 tbsp salt
  • ½ tbsp fresh cracked black pepper
  • 3 tbsp fresh chopped dill

PREPARATION:

  1. Preheat your oven to 425 degrees with the baking sheet inside.
  2. Remove the chicken thighs from the Force of Nature packaging
  3. Pat the chicken dry with a paper towel
  4. Season the chicken heavily with the poultry seasoning, salt, garlic powder, and onion powder.
  5. In a bowl, season the cubed potatoes with a generous pour of extra virgin ol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
  6. Remove the hot baking sheet out of the oven and place the cubed potatoes in the pan (you should hear a sizzling noise here)
  7. On the same pan, wedge the seasoned chicken thighs among the cubed potatoes
  8. Roast for 25 minutes and then drizzle some olive oil over the chicken thighs and place back into the oven for 20 more minutes.
  9. Add the tzatziki ingredients to a bowl, mix well, and set aside.
  10. After roasting for 45 minutes, turn off the oven with the baking sheet of chicken and potatoes inside, and let cool for another 15-20 minutes
  11. Remove the baking sheet from the oven
  12. Squeeze a lemon over the roasted chicken
  13. Drizzle the homemade tzatziki over the roasted potatoes and chicken thighs and enjoy!
